22RE rebuild for the first timer.... where to begin??

Okay, so I got a spare engine off craigslist for 100 bucks. Blown head gasket. I put my son down for a nap and had the long block competly apart by the time he woke up. Way easier then I expected.
So now I have all these parts head and block to put back together.... I took the block in and had it steam cleaned they said it hadn't ever been rebuilt.
SO.... where do I begin with the block??? I know just enough about parts replacing to be dangerous, just now venturing into the inner workings for the first time. I'm going to "play" dumb. So break it down barney style for me. Thanks.

did they hone the cylinders?, if i were you ide get the block checked for cracks, surfaced (i think thats what its called....they mill the part were the head connects for a flat surface) and bore it .30 over and then order all your parts accordingly from Engnbldr.com good reputable toyota engine guy, and has great customer service, and while your at it ide get a cam for the motor too, tell Ted what your gonna be using the motor for and he can suggest a cam.. also SEARCH!!! alot of people have rebuilt their motors and take CRAPTONS of photos.....maily superbleader

I say RESEARCH

I did about 3 months worth of research to get all the components I wanted to get the most out of my motor without going to far and losing the long life and reliability and still ended up with about 140-145 H.P.

For the record I had no books/guides to help me and this was my first time rebuilding one of these never did more then oil and tune up's prior to the full rebuild, all the info I got to rebuild mine came from this site and searching 22re rebuild in the search field the rest was from members answering questions I had along the way.
